Job Title: Director of Engineering
Location: Cambridge
 
An innovative and fast-growing fabless semiconductor company is seeking a Director of Engineering to lead and scale a multidisciplinary engineering team that spans IC Design, RF Design, Embedded Software and Systems.
 
This is a unique opportunity to join a pioneering organisation developing cutting-edge RF technology for the mobile and wearables industry, with a mission to redefine how RF front-ends are designed.
 
The Director of Engineering role is ideal for an experienced and driven engineering leader who thrives in a high-growth, collaborative environment and is excited by the opportunity to shape engineering processes, culture, and technical excellence from the ground up.
 
Key Responsibilities:

Provide line management to a diverse team across RFIC, system integration, module design, and embedded software.
Set clear performance expectations and support professional development across the team.
Define and implement engineering best practices, including design reviews, version control, and documentation standards.
Promote scalable methodologies for ICs, RF modules, and embedded software.
Establish robust processes for simulation, measurement, validation, and compliance.
Drive effective day-to-day engineering execution and resource planning.
Contribute to long-term strategic planning and roadmap development.  
Qualifications & Experience:

Proven track record in engineering leadership, ideally within a fabless semiconductor
Hands-on experience managing multidisciplinary teams across IC design, software, and validation functions.
Strong background in engineering lifecycle management
Technical expertise in RFIC, analog/mixed-signal design, or RF module development.
Passionate about team development and building scalable engineering cultures.
